自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(37)
  • 收藏
  • 关注

原创 【已解决】springboot集成jsp,启动后无法访问jsp,访问jsp页面报404

我以为问题是jar包版本冲突或者application.yml配置有问题,期间我也怀疑过是否是文件夹名称的问题,但是我又觉得不可能像SpringMVC的文件上传一样要求文件名必须一致,所以我就没在意。我的idea是2023版本的,所以创建maven项目的时候不会再自动构建webapp,需要自己选中项目右键选择web框架,因为这个操作导致idea自动创建的文件夹名称是web,不是webapp。同时自动构建的文件夹不会放在src/main文件夹下,而是和src目录同级。这个问题出现的原因让我非常无语。

2023-04-07 17:49:16 1944

原创 【已解决】无法在web.xml或使用此应用程序部署的jar文件中解析绝对uri:[http://java.sun.com/jsp/jstl/core]

这个jar包也会出现无法在web.xml或使用此应用程序部署的jar文件中解析绝对uri这个问题,至于其他的standard.jar,standard-impl等等jar包我都没有引入,Tomcat的lib中我也没有添加其他解决方案中的jar包,也可以使用。解决时间:2023/3/31,我使用的tomcat是8.5版本的,在整合SSM项目时在jsp中使用JSTL的核心标签库 - core,也就是使用。有知道的大佬麻烦说明一下,解答我的疑惑。,搜索出来的方法都没成功,这个是我页面上出现的报错。

2023-03-31 23:35:32 3330 2

原创 【已解决】web.xml中servlet-class报错

由于编译环境中有javaEE容器规范的检测,会导致servlet-class编译报错。比如在servlet-class标签中引入SpringMVC核心Servlet。

2023-03-27 21:54:40 1010

转载 int和Integer各自的应用场景

当然,如果系统限定db里int字段不允许null值,则也可考虑将属性定义为int。Integer提供了一系列数据的成员和操作,如Integer.MAX_VALUE,Integer.valueOf(),Integer.compare(),compareTo(),不过一般用的比较少。建议,一般用int类型,这样一方面省去了拆装箱,另一方面也会规避数据比较时可能带来的bug。对于应用程序里定义的枚举类型, 其值如果是整型,则最好定义为int,方便与相关的其他int值或Integer值的比较。

2023-02-24 08:42:26 848

转载 MySql8.0版本 The user specified as a definer (‘root‘@‘%‘) does not exist已解决

查询资料后,发现是版本的问题,8.0.11版本之后移除了grant 语句添加用户的功能,也就是说grant…只能适用于已存在的账户,不能通过 grant…新版本数据库语句和老版本数据库语句会有差别,个人学习还是推荐使用老版本,出现各种问题方便找到办法。链接:https://www.jianshu.com/p/8bd666d68545。商业转载请联系作者获得授权,非商业转载请注明出处。网上查了下相关问题的处理方法,基本都是这句。mysql8.0 以后这句的用法不一样了。

2023-02-03 11:48:14 954 2

原创 浏览器打印,Chrome网页打印中的宽度控制

按照1英寸=25.41mm换算,A4纸张可实际显示的像素宽度为794px×1123px,即打印网页的宽度为794px。Return location.reload在这里是刷新的意思,如果没有这句代码打印完后要重新刷新一次网页才能再次打印。实际打印还会有页边距,如果页边距为5mm(窄边距),网页内容最大宽度约750px,若页边距为19mm(默认边距),网页内最大元素分辨率约650px。思路:先用一个div把要打印的页面包裹起来,再将打印的部分转换成HTML格式,然后触发打印事件。其一,锁定网页的宽度。

2023-01-07 15:18:40 2825

原创 mysql获取月份名称缩写

使用DATENAME()函数是取得月份的英文全称,但报表需要,只需显示月份名称缩写,使用DATE_FORMAT()函数格式化date值即可MySQL日期时间DATE_FORMAT函数参数

2022-12-07 17:12:28 644

转载 【Eclipse中Java文件图标由实心J变成空心J的问题】

转载于:https://www.cnblogs.com/dashuai01/p/6039961.html。在eclipse中空心J的java文件,表示不被包含在项目中进行编译,而是当做资源存在项目中。1.右击该文件 – >BuildPath -->Include。当是单个文件为空心J的时候。

2022-11-30 11:46:43 170

原创 IDEA项目启动中报错命令行过长已解决

报错信息:Error running ‘JsaasApplication’: Command line is too long. Shorten command line for JsaasApplication or also for Spring Boot default configuration.解决:1.修改配置,在 Add Run Options里选择Shorten command line,然后选择JAR manifest...

2022-07-04 17:30:28 2090

转载 java.lang.ClassNotFoundException: org.apache.taglibs.standard.tlv.JstlCoreTLV 已解决

原因:少了standard.jar 和 jstl.jar导致的。解决:①可以在下载菜鸟教程的:jakarta-taglibs-standard-1.1.2.zip,②也可以在自己电脑的tomcat里找到他们,路径是C:\Program Files\Java\apache-tomcat-8.5.33\webapps\examples\WEB-INF\lib第二步,在jsp页面的里面加一句话完成。这样就可以了,在页面写一句jstl语句测试即可:转载:jsp项目使用jstl(c标签)及jstl.jar和s

2022-07-03 20:17:26 1011

原创 idea边栏消失-已解决

idea边栏消失

2022-06-30 09:55:06 250

原创 struts2项目部署到tomcat浏览器浏览显示$end$

原因:没有部署到正确web目录下,idea识别不出来,这个ENDENDEND 是默认的index页面,在struts.xml文件中/index.jsp前面少写了一个view文件夹解决:在/index.jsp前面加上/view

2022-06-18 18:58:34 1896

原创 The field imgFile exceeds its maximum permitted size of 1048576 bytes.

The field imgFile exceeds its maximum permitted size of 1048576 bytes.显示文件的大小超出了允许的范围。每个文件的配置最大为1Mb,单次请求的文件的总数不能大10Mb。要更改这个默认值需要在配置文件(application.properties)中加入两个配置。...

2022-06-18 11:25:50 1296

原创 Failed to convert from type java.lang.String to type java.util.Date for value ‘2019-09-09‘;

Failed to convert from type java.lang.String to type java.util.Date for value ‘2019-09-09’;日期格式转换异常原因:在Java中如果没有对日期进行处理的话,默认格式类似于Fri Dec 20 00:00:00 CST 2013这样,而为我们现在要保存的日期格式为yyyy-MM-dd所以会转换错误。解决:1.在实体类的日期属性上添加注解:@DateTimeFormat(pattern = “yyyy-MM-dd”)...

2022-06-18 11:18:24 1226

原创 java.text.ParseException: Unparseable date: “FQC20170103-000428“

java.text.ParseException: Unparseable date: “FQC20170103-000428” 不能转换日期原因:1.字段类型为日期,数据为字符串,转换报错

2022-06-15 20:45:11 158

原创 java封装json字符串

小白入门级

2022-06-02 18:06:33 708

原创 @RequestParam和@PathVariable的用法和@RequestBody的用法

小白入门级教程

2022-06-02 10:57:17 276

原创 解决 column to be modified must be empty to decrease precision or scale

column to be modified must be empty to decrease precision or scale 要修改的列必须为空以降低精度或比例原因:1.要修改的列存在数据2.要修改的列数据类型精度较高解决:1.删除列数据2.降低列数据的精度...

2022-05-25 17:18:22 1649

原创 解决 duplicate column name

duplicate column name ,列名重复。原因:1.有重复的列解决:1.删除其中一个列

2022-05-25 17:13:50 22641

原创 There is already ‘ ‘ bean method 解决方案

controller 的mapping报错仔细看是这句问题:to {GET [/smt/test/queryByFactory]}: There is already ‘smgCheckResultController’ bean method已经存在/smt/test/queryByFactory这个地址,需要更改这个地址。

2022-05-24 09:28:07 1653

原创 java用fastjson解析多层嵌套复杂json字符串

1 []中括号代表的是一个数组;2 {}大括号代表的是一个对象3 双引号“”表示的是属性值4 冒号:代表的是前后之间的关系,冒号前面是属性的名称,后面是属性的值,这个值可以是基本数据类型,也可以是引用数据类型。Fastjson中的经常调用的方法parseObject(String text);: 把JSON文本parse成JSONObjectparse(String text);: 把JSON文本parse为JSONObject或者JSONArraykey 必须是字符串,value 可以是.

2022-05-17 19:41:46 5678

原创 idea对Properties 文件进行专门的编码设置

IntelliJ IDEA 可以对 Properties 文件进行专门的编码设置,也建议改为 UTF-8,其中有一个重点就是属性 Transparent native-to-ascii conversion,一般都要勾选,不然 Properties 文件中的注释显示的都不会是中文...

2022-05-13 11:18:17 2735

原创 解决 ORA-00942: table or view does not exist

ORA-00942: table or view does not exist 表或视图不存在原因:1.表或视图名称拼写错误2.表或视图在其他用户下,或用户名写错比如:t_tab_user这个表只用 hangzhou 用户才有,但用了其他用户链接数据库,就无法读取到该表...

2022-05-06 16:31:35 30853

转载 三年 Git 使用心得 & 常见问题整理

原文

2022-05-05 17:41:10 43

原创 在自己的网站上添加HTML悬浮音乐播放器APlayer & MetingJS

官方文档https://github.com/MoePlayer/APlayerhttps://github.com/metowolf/MetingJS引入线上的js代码放到你的HTML结构页面中,link链接放在head内部即可。替换div中的网易云ID号即可在header上添加<link rel="stylesheet" href="https://cdn.jsdelivr.net/npm/[email protected]/dist/APlayer.min.css"><s

2022-05-04 19:19:11 2218

原创 解决 mybatis-plus:org.apache.ibatis.binding.BindingException: Invalid bound statement (not found)

mybatis配置文件的问题本人报错原因:yml文件中xml文件配置路径名称错误,com写成了cn其他原因产生的问题:检查xml文件所在package名称是否和Mapper interfacel所在的包名是否一致<mapper namespace="cn.lgqyun.dao.UserDao">mapper的namespace写的不对!!!注意修改。UserDao的方法在UserDao.Xml中没有,然后执行UserDao的方法会报此UserDaol的方法返回值是List,而

2022-05-04 17:04:06 490

原创 解决 springboot 部署报错Input length = 1 或者 Input length = 2

org.yaml.snakeyaml.error.YAMLException: java.nio.charset.MalformedInputExcep原因:1.yml文件中的文字编码是gbk格式解决:1.在idea中打开settings–Editor-File Econdings,设置yml为UTF-82.将yml内容复制,把application.yml删除,内容通过记事本修改成UTF-8格式再重新创建改文件,将内容放进去3.在settings中设置好yml编码,不用删除yml文件,Bu.

2022-05-04 16:00:16 1245

转载 Thymeleaf语法总结

原文链接

2022-05-04 14:44:57 39

原创 宝塔面板搭建onenav – 使用PHP开发的简约导航/书签管理系统

OneNav,使用PHP + SQLite 3开发的简约导航/书签管理器。不熟悉docker安装的可以用宝塔搭建体验了一番,效果不错。觉得麻烦也可以去宝塔软件商店中一键部署。1.准备PHP7.3nginx1.22.部署1)解析好域名,宝塔创建网站1.打开购买域名的厂商官网,登陆后在页面右上角找到 控制台 或 相关管理后台入口。2.在域名厂商的控制台中,找到您的域名解析添加页面,例如:a. 阿里云:在控制台页面的左侧,产品与服务栏中选择 域名。b. 腾讯云:在控制台的云产品中,搜索并选择

2022-04-29 21:22:24 3550

原创 解决 FROM keyword not found where expected

FROM keyword not found where expected,在预期的地方找不到 FROM 关键字原因:1.查询时FROM 单词拼写错误解决:1.检查查询语句中from关键字是否拼写正确,时常将from和form混淆

2022-04-29 11:43:12 15451 2

原创 解决ORA-00904: invalid identifier

原因:1.创建表时没有插入字段,查询时字段在表中不存在2.字段名写错了解决:1.查看数据表结构中的字段是否存在或写错了

2022-04-29 11:37:20 93086 1

原创 ORA-01747: user.table.column, table.column 或列说明无效 异常解决方法总结

原因:创建表时使用了group作为字段名称,查询语句中使用了group字段,而group是ORACEL的关键字,所以查询时出错。解决:1.创建表是不使用ORACLE的关键字作为表字段名。2.oracle 表字段关键字的查询 : 把字段名加上双引号,并且严格区分大小写。建议采用第一种方法解决,减少出现其他问题的几率。...

2022-04-28 18:06:33 3840

原创 idea让包名折叠

或者

2022-04-25 21:58:08 2679 2

原创 PowerDesigner 批量添加字段、转换大小写、导出Excel脚本工具

提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档文章目录批量修改表大小写,字段大小写和数据类型批量修改成大写批量导出Excel批量导出Excel(第二种)给指定表添加字段给所有表添加公共字段批量修改表大小写,字段大小写和数据类型'Option Explicit OnValidationMode = TrueInteractiveMode = im_BatchDim mdl ' the current model' 取得当前ModelSet mdl = ActiveMod.

2022-04-13 11:36:19 1038

转载 PowerDesigner最基础的使用方法入门学习(一)

作者: liangxb出处:[https://www.cnblogs.com/lxbmaomao/]本文版权归作者和博客园共有,欢迎转载,但未经作者同意必须保留此段声明,且在文章页面明显位置给出原文连接,否则保留追究法律责任的权利。...

2022-03-31 12:51:43 131

转载 @Mapper和@Repository注解的区别

这两种注解的区别在于:1、使用@mapper后,不需要在spring配置中设置扫描地址,通过mapper.xml里面的namespace属性对应相关的mapper类,spring将动态的生成Bean后注入到ServiceImpl中。2、@repository则需要在Spring中配置扫描包地址,然后生成dao层的bean,之后被注入到ServiceImpl中链接:https://www.jianshu.com/p/3942f6b4fa75...

2022-03-23 10:25:19 2302

原创 eclipse【问题汇总】

在eclipse文件路径中不能出现中文名称,否则打不开文件,如下图所示:

2022-02-24 21:34:02 220

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除